Hey Alex!
I'd say the Photobucket debarkle has alot to answer for with the forums. Once they wiped Billions of images from forums all over the world, all the forums dropped in participation. Which forced others to social media where its quick & easy. One forum that bucked the trend was Model Cars where they allowed people to upload to their website, no 3rd party hosting. Which is great, & there are some great builders over there, sadly its mostly American orientated & JDM, Euro builds don't get as much attention as the US stuff. Its a great idea to upload images to this website but I doubt if AF would do that considering the modelling sub forum is the most active.
Personally I've been building quite alot in the last few years, I guess I fall into the too lazy to upload & post (which I need to change!), I've also recently joined Instagram which I've found is really great for modeling, there's heaps of younger guys (I'm only 34, but there's plenty under 30) & there doing some really cool builds reflecting current trends etc.
I too remember fondly the glory days of this forum, the 60th Ferrari Build was amazing & the Porsche Cayman Interseries still remain highlights! As to the future of this forum, I guess its in our hands. A similar forum tried a group build to gather more interest, more posts etc, with prizes up for grabs. Think there were only around 15-20 people participating & only a few finished on time, still no prizes awarded, it just kinda died off.
I like the idea of AFMOTY18, or maybe just a thread of 'your 2018 builds'...

Well, I'm guilty of laziness too. And yes, PB's colossal F'up really turned a lot of people away from forums. Even though I dont use social media for social media I have joined up with FB and have been posting in a bunch of modeling forums. I find it great, especially if you're working on a project and have an issue, you're almost guaranteed an immediate response from someone, somewhere in the world. I think the "LIKE" feature helps a lot as well. Many times I'll look at someones post in a forum and go, "yeah, I like it" but dont have much else to say or add so I dont leave a comment. On FB I can just hit the "LIKE" button and the builder can see that I and others like their work without having to type it out. Yes, maybe a bit lazy but at the same time, 40 replies of "looks good" doesnt help people get better or learn either. I for one like criticisms, constructive of course. I learn more from someone saying " looks good, but had you have done this or that, it would look better". When I joined FB to post in modeling forums I was worried about getting a lot of "mean people" slamming people's work cause it didnt measure up to their standards, but I've honestly not seen that yet in the year or so since I've starting using FB more than forums. This was the first online forum I joined, and still my favourite, and I"d love to see it revitalized. I learned a ton off the amazing builders who use to post, and some that still do, but would like to see the traffic increase for sure. One thing I loved about this forum was that there seems to be a wide range of interests here, more so than some of the other forums which I find seem to be more centralized in scope. Here's hoping this can thread can help bring more people back.
